The services listed usually start with anti-wrinkle injections for forehead lines, frown lines and crow's feet, then extend to dermal fillers used for lips, cheeks, chin, jawline and the nasolabial folds. Skin boosters and deep-hydration injectables are offered where the aim is skin quality rather than shape, with mesotherapy, PRP for face or scalp and profile balancing available at many clinics. Practitioners serving residents of Al Thammam typically plan these as staged courses with reviews rather than one-off appointments, and they should be candid when a concern would be better handled by something other than an injectable.
Everything should begin with a consultation. A licensed practitioner will take a medical history, ask about medication, allergies and previous injectables, look carefully at how your face rests and moves, and explain the proposed product, quantity, cost and expected longevity. Reputable clinics talk about gradual, natural-looking change and temporary results instead of guarantees, mention that swelling and small bruises are common in the first days, and hand over written aftercare with a date to come back for review.
